    From Sport.ru...

    WBA/WBO/IBF Heavyweight Champ Wladimir Klitschko (57-3, 50 KOs) is ready to go with his upcoming rematch against Tony Thompson on July 7th in Berne, but he won't rule out the possibility of returning to the United States, possibly in the month of November. He has two opponents in mind for November, Seth Mitchell (24-0-1, 18 KOs) or Chris Arreola (35-2, 30 KOs). Wladimir has not fought in the United States in February 2008, when he dominated Sultran Ibragimov in New York's Madison Square Garden.

    "[After Thompson] I'm going to return to the ring once again [in 2012], probably in November. At this moment we can not talk about specific dates or opponents, but I won't not rule out the possibility of this fight taking place in the United States. There are two interesting players - Seth Mitchell and Chris Arreola, who after losing to my brother managed to once again return to the forefront," Klitschko said.
